were two brilliant and ambitious young Labour MPs determined to turn their party of perennial protest into a natural party of government. They fought and argued their way to the 1997 landslide. They won three elections in a row, an unprecedented achievement, and both served as prime minister – two of only six leaders from their party to occupy No 10.
